The new Ford Puma has sacrificed nothing of the practicality that characterizes it over the years. The flexible and innovative loading space uses MegaBox to transfer two sets of golf sticks to an upright position or wet and muddy equipment after outdoor activities as it is washed and cleaned easily. MegaBox offers an additional 80 litres of storage space on the floor of the luggage space, which means that objects up to about 115 cm high can be stored upright. With MegaBox the luggage space has a capacity of 456 litres with the rear seats in place, while with their full folding the maximum capacity reaches 1,216 litres. And all this in a vehicle only 4.2 meters long. Ford Puma therefore comfortably meets the needs of family holidays and other escapes with a trunk capable of filling with luggage or sports equipment. With design that enhances practicality and spaces The exterior design of the new Puma is based on the distinctive character of Ford’s most popular passenger car in Europe with improvements that maintain its unique charm and enhance its practicality and wideness. In front there is Ford’s new signal, flanked by brand new lighting bodies, with a new light signature in a “nail” style, which enhances the impressive presence of the new Ford Puma on the road. Titanium versions of the model are inspired by the older sister of the new Puma – the new Kuga – with a chrome-free mask, which gives a youthful appearance. ST-Line versions adopt a unique, sporty design in the front, with the impressive ST-Line X additionally possess an exclusive rear aerometry. The new Ford Puma is available in six impressive colors, including the new one for the Cactus Grey model, while it can be equipped with aluminum rims with a diameter of 17 to 19 inches, depending on the version.
